“The potency is just in the hearing,” we would tell them….”The better you hear attentively, the better the effect will be. Just listen to each sound and syllable and when your mind wanders to other things (trust me on this one–it will) just gently bring your focus back to the sound. Maybe a half hour each day to start and be determined to repeat the process the next day and practice bringing your attention back and focusing on the sound.”

“I promise you, after a week’s time you will experience a result. The effect that you will experience will be that you will notice that your consciousness has risen higher–above things. Your perspective will change because your consciousness has been elevated to where you will see things differently –from a more purified perspective.”

Also, if they were a little pious and advanced spiritually, we would tell them more…”Chanting Hare Krsna does not work because it relaxes the mind, or something similar. It works because Krsna, being absolute, is in His Name. When you hear His Name you actually experience contact with His presence, though imperceptible at this stage, all of which has a purifying effect on your consciousness.”

“A little faith might be required to start the process but if a person is sincere and practices as I have described then the results will be there. Next week you will be saying “Wow, it does work” Go on, what have you got to loose……….”

Bhagavana Dasa and I (with sign) on the streets of Detroit in 1969

Of course, now many remember her as such a great soul, and I don’t have to go into much detail.

Gradually our ranks grew as we were all compelled by Bhagavana Dasa’s determination and exceptional leadership to go out day after day and chant the Holy Name. Many new devotees joined us at this time, at a rate that was probably unique for ISKCON temples. Anyone who was around in those days knew that Detroit was a strong force in bringing others to devotional service.

I have to give some of the credit for our success, I suppose, to Bhagavan Dasa’s expert abilities, but really, as I look back, I understand it was Krsna’s mercy to us because we were so willing to surrender completely to trying to please His pure devotee. Also, the devotees back then were so sincere to help the suffering souls who had never experienced the nectar of devotion.
